SCALLOPED SWEET CORN CASSEROLE



Scalloped Sweet Corn Casserole image

This is my Grandma Ostendorf's corn recipe I grew up enjoying. Now a grandmother myself, I still serve this comfy, delicious side as a family classic. -Lonnie Hartstack, Clarinda, Iowa

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Side Dishes

Time 1h15m

Yield 8 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 14

4 teaspoons cornstarch
2/3 cup water
1/4 cup butter, cubed
3 cups fresh or frozen corn
1 can (5 ounces) evaporated milk
3/4 teaspoon plus 1-1/2 teaspoons sugar, divided
1/2 teaspoon plus 3/4 teaspoon salt, divided
3 large eggs
3/4 cup 2% milk
1/4 teaspoon pepper
3 cups cubed bread
1 small onion, chopped
1 cup Rice Krispies, slightly crushed
3 tablespoons butter, melted

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350°. In a small bowl, mix cornstarch and water until smooth. In a large saucepan, heat butter over medium heat. Stir in corn, evaporated milk, 3/4 teaspoon sugar and 1/2 teaspoon salt; bring just to a boil. Stir in cornstarch mixture; return to a boil, stirring constantly. Cook and stir 1-2 minutes or until thickened; cool slightly., In a large bowl, whisk eggs, milk, pepper and the remaining sugar and salt until blended. Stir in bread, onion and corn mixture. Transfer to a greased 8-in. square or 1-1/2-qt. baking dish., Bake, uncovered, 40 minutes. In a small bowl, toss Rice Krispies with melted butter; sprinkle over casserole. Bake 10-15 minutes longer or until golden brown. Freeze option: Cool unbaked casserole, reserving Rice Krispies topping for baking; cover and freeze. To use, partially thaw in refrigerator overnight. Remove from refrigerator 30 minutes before baking. Preheat oven to 350°. Bake casserole as directed, increasing time as necessary to heat through and for a thermometer inserted in center to read 165°.

EASY SCALLOPED CORN CASSEROLE



Easy Scalloped Corn Casserole image

"This is my family's all-time favorite corn dish. The buttery cornflake topping and chopped green peppers inside give it a different twist," writes Nancy McDonald from Burns, Wyoming. "It is always a success at potluck dinners. Plus, it's special enough to plan into a holiday meal or buffet."

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Side Dishes

Time 45m

Yield 6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 13

1/2 cup chopped green pepper
1/4 cup chopped onion
2 teaspoons canola oil
1 tablespoon all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on paprika
1/4 teaspoon ground mustard
Dash white pepper
1 cup fat-free evaporated milk
1 package (16 ounces) frozen corn, thawed
1/4 cup egg substitute
1/3 cup crushed cornflakes
2 teaspoons butter, melted

Steps:

  • In a large nonstick skillet, saute green pepper and onion in oil until tender. In a small bowl, combine the flour, salt, paprika, mustard and pepper. Stir in milk until smooth. Add mixture to skillet; bring to a boil. Cook and stir for 2 minutes or until thickened. Remove from the heat; stir in corn and egg substitute., Transfer to a 1-qt. baking dish coated with cooking spray. Combine cornflakes and butter; sprinkle over the top., Bake, uncovered, at 350° for 30 minutes or until a thermometer reads 160° and center is almost set. Let stand for 10 minutes before serving.

OLD-FASHIONED SCALLOPED CORN



Old-Fashioned Scalloped Corn image

Delicious country style creamed corn casserole, a family favorite! Originally submitted to ThanksgivingRecipe.com.

Provided by Cali

Categories     Side Dish     Casseroles     Corn Casserole Recipes

Yield 10

Number Of Ingredients 6

3 (15 ounce) cans creamed corn
2 eggs
1 cup crushed saltine crackers
½ cup butter
½ teaspoon paprika
¼ teaspoon ground black pepper

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Butter one 8x11x2 inch casserole dish.
  • In a medium sized mixing bowl, combine the creamed corn, eggs, 1/4 cup of the melted butter and 1/2 of the cracker crumbs. Pour mixture in into the prepared dish.
  • In a small bowl, mix the remaining melted butter, cracker crumbs, paprika and pepper. Sprinkle crumb topping over the casserole.
  • Bake at 350 degrees F (175 degrees C) for 30 to 40 minutes, until topping browns slightly and corn is bubbly around the edges.

SCALLOPED CORN AND OYSTERS



Scalloped Corn and Oysters image

A family favorite, handed down from grandmother, to my mother to me. Terribly easy and a fabulous side dish for a Thanksgiving dinner. Oysters can be left out, but honestly it isn't as good. :)

Provided by Jen Wiehl

Categories     Corn

Time 50m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

3 tablespoons butter
2 tablespoons flour
2 tablespoons sugar
1/2 teaspoon salt
3 eggs, beaten
2 cups frozen corn
1 3/4 cups milk
1 jar oyster, drained and chopped

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 325 degrees.
  • Butter a 1 1/2 qt baking dish.
  • Mix butter, flour, sugar and salt with fork in a large bowl until blended.
  • Add the eggs and beat well.
  • Stir in corn and milk.
  • Stir in oysters.
  • Pour into dish and bake for 20 minutes.
  • Stir again and continue baking until golden and an inserted knife comes out clean.

JIFFY SCALLOPED CORN CASSEROLE



Jiffy Scalloped Corn Casserole image

Make and share this Jiffy Scalloped Corn Casserole recipe from Food.com.

Provided by Jo in Arlington

Categories     Cheese

Time 1h5m

Yield 10 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

2 eggs
1 (14 ounce) can creamed corn
1 (14 ounce) can whole kernel corn (undrained)
1 cup sour cream
1 (8 ounce) package Jiffy cornbread mix
1/2 cup melted butter
1 cup shredded cheddar cheese

Steps:

  • Beat eggs slightly.
  • Add sour cream, butter and corn.
  • Fold in dry Jiffy corn mix.
  • Put in baking disk (I used a 9 x 7).
  • Sprinkle cheese on top.
  • Bake at 350 for 45-60 minutes.
  • Make sure center comes out clean.
  • Another rendition is to mix in the cheese-- this was very good since it spread the cheese throughout the corn.

SCALLOPED CORN CASSEROLE (SHIRLEY STYLE)



SCALLOPED CORN CASSEROLE (SHIRLEY STYLE) image

Number Of Ingredients 10

16 oz cream corn
1 cup celery (I like about 1/2)
1/4 cup onions
3/4 cup American cheese (I use cheddar to avoid the overl processed stuff)
1 cup cracker crumbs (saltines)
1 tsp salt
2 eggs
2 Tbs butter
1/4 tsp paprika
1 cup milk

Steps:

  • 1. Preheat oven to 350. Combine chopped celery, onions, cheese, cracker crumbs, salt and butter. 2. When ready to bake, add cream corn, eggs and milk. Stir to combine. 3. Spray casserole dish, if desired. Pour casserole mixture into dish and top with paprika. Bake for 50 min at ~350. (I sometimes find I need an extra ~5-10 minutes for the desired crispy top.
